Letter from Samuel Joseph May, South Scituate, [Massachusetts], to William Lloyd Garrison, 1839 June 15

Samuel Joseph May writes to William Lloyd Garrison about the schedule for the upcoming county Anti-Slavery society meeting, planned for the fourth of July. May asks Garrison to suggest some "topics which ought to be made the subjects of resolutions - and ask Mrs. Chapman and M...
